Jonathan Toews reportedly expected to return from back injury Saturday vs. Flyers

Chicago Blackhawks captain Jonathan Toews is expected to return from a back injury Saturday in Philadelphia, reports Mark Lazerus of the Chicago Sun Times. A report Tuesday, indicated the injury is not “considered serious.”

Toews has already missed three straight games due to the injury and is likely to miss a fourth when Chicago hosts the New Jersey Devils on Thursday. He sustained the injury last week on the Circus Trip at San Jose, when he fell awkwardly in the second period and did not return.

Despite his absence, Chicago has found the win column, going 2-0-1. However, they’ve struggled mightily on faceoffs without their No. 1 center. The Hawks won just 27 percent of draws at Anaheim in their first game without Toews. Since then, they’ve steadily improved against Los Angeles (36 percent) and Florida (47 percent).

Toews has recorded four goals and eight assists in 21 games this season.
